Abstract :
Observation of analogue signals coming directly from the processes remains an indispensable tool in Particle Accelerator operation. The system presently used in the new CPS control system, allows analogue signals to be selectively routed at the operator consoles: (i) 32 out of 1600 signals to oscilloscopes, (ii) 10 out of 40 triggers for these oscilloscopes and (iii) 8 out of 80 video signals for TV monitors. These signals can also be observed on local oscilloscopes. An optimised multiplexing structure is used, the transmission range is several hundred meters and the bandwidth is from DC to 25 MHz. The switch network is controlled by a computer program which directs signals requested to the console oscilloscopes and, where required by the optimised nature of the network, reroutes previously chosen signals without disturbing the observer. A central interactive database is used and signals are chosen through a tree-structure from touch panels on the operator consoles.
